What affects the price

Roofing repairs vary based on a few key factors. The total square footage of the damaged area, the accessibility of your roof, and the specific materials needed for a proper patch all play a role. If there is underlying rot or water damage to the deck beneath your shingles, that adds to the labor and supplies required. About this service

Metal roofing is a long-lasting option chosen for its fire resistance and energy efficiency. It requires professional maintenance to check that panels remain sealed and fasteners stay tight against the roof deck. You should call for service if you spot bent panels, damaged flashing, or signs of leaking around chimneys and vents. Keeping metal secure is key to preventing wind uplift. What is involved in installing metal roofing in Tucson?

Installing metal roofing in Tucson typically involves preparing the roof deck, applying protective underlayment, and then carefully fastening the metal panels. Pros ensure proper overlap and sealing of seams to prevent the intense desert sun and occasional rains from causing damage. Ventilation and flashing are also critical components addressed during installation to ensure longevity.

What is a single-ply roofing membrane and its use in Tucson?

A single-ply roofing membrane is a synthetic material used for flat or low-slope roofs, common in some Tucson architecture. Materials like TPO and EPDM are installed in large sheets, offering a durable, waterproof barrier against the harsh sun and heat. What are the benefits of EPDM roofing in Tucson?

EPDM roofing offers excellent durability and resistance to UV radiation, making it a strong choice for Tucson's intense sun. It's a flexible material that can withstand temperature fluctuations without cracking. EPDM is also known for its longevity and relatively low maintenance requirements, making it a cost-effective solution for flat or low-slope roofs in our climate.

What are the options for asphalt shingle roofs in Tucson?

For asphalt shingle roofs in Tucson, options range from standard 3-tab shingles to architectural shingles, which offer a more dimensional look and increased durability. Lighter colored shingles can also help reflect solar heat, potentially reducing cooling costs.
